Output 51d159b63ca64b6b57c115e20e8ec94de2b2c21d609cc466b95d54d5e971f576:0

value
125740000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 253d3eb8fe6b7d5c3b379983b0704462046ebeba OP_EQUALVERIFY OP_CHECKSIG
address
14PuNUb4QJWwcf3UfvpvNo2WK21oaiQyCS
transaction
51d159b63ca64b6b57c115e20e8ec94de2b2c21d609cc466b95d54d5e971f576
confirmations
666678
spent
true